Bonikowo is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Kościan, within Kościan County, Greater Poland Voivodeship, in west-central Poland.

== Population == As of the 2011 census, the village of Bonikowo in Gmina Kościan, Kościan County, Greater Poland Voivodeship, Poland, had a population of 499, By 2021 this figure was estimated at 514, comprising 255 males and 259 females.
